Selective mono-facial modification of graphene oxide nanosheets in suspension
Brendan T McGrail1, Joey D Mangadlao, Bradley J Rodier
1Department of Chemistry, Case Western Reserve University, 10900 Euclid Ave, Cleveland, OH 44106, USA. Ebp24@case.edu.
Abstract:
Graphene oxide (GO) is selectively functionalized on one face to prepare Janus platelets which are characterized by various spectroscopic and microscopic techniques. With this methodology, Janus GO platelets can be prepared without the use of a solid substrate and the two platelet faces can be orthogonally modified in a one-pot reaction.
